Output 93ab66f7874809165b575d79f31a0c58101e77891fd66edd8c2418ba48f8e78f:1

value
2314560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ba5524045d95d9d5c9f1b4fafb15460d5417ce00 OP_EQUALVERIFY OP_CHECKSIG
address
1HzEgMr6BpaVJhwev6CU8CjE2H1Pv3NCB7
transaction
93ab66f7874809165b575d79f31a0c58101e77891fd66edd8c2418ba48f8e78f
spent
true